
OPhone游戏编程入门:从零开始的坦克大战
下载需积分: 10 | 1.02MB |
更新于2024-10-20
| 162 浏览量 | 举报
收藏
"Android 从零开始OPhone游戏编程"
这篇教程是针对初学者的Android OPhone游戏开发指南,由邢野撰写,旨在介绍OPhone平台的游戏编程基础知识,并通过实例项目——复刻坦克大战游戏,让读者熟悉2D游戏编程的基本流程。OPhone是基于Linux的移动操作系统,适用于手机、MID、NetBook等设备,其SDK提供了开发所需的各种工具和文档。
写作本文的初衷是为了推广OPhone编程知识,鼓励更多人进入这个领域,特别是对Java语言有一定了解并且能够使用Eclipse的开发者。虽然标题提及“从零开始”,但并不适合完全不懂编程的读者。文章各章节标注了难度,允许读者根据自身水平选择性阅读。
文章内容分为多个章节,从搭建OPhone开发环境开始。在第一章中,作者提到搭建环境的过程在Windows操作系统下进行,官方也提供了Linux环境的安装指南。开发环境的配置对于任何开发者来说都是第一步,它包括安装OPhone SDK,其中包含OPhone API、模拟器、开发工具、示例代码和帮助文档。
接下来的章节逐步深入,从创建第一个OPhone程序HelloTank开始,讲解如何显示文字和图片、响应用户事件,然后逐步涉及更复杂的主题,如SurfaceView动画、精灵和帧动画的实现,以及碰撞检测。这些章节涵盖了游戏开发的核心技术,如游戏逻辑控制、图形渲染和用户交互处理。
在游戏开发中,地图的设计和实现也是一个关键环节。第八章预计会讨论如何设计动态变化的地图,以及在OPhone平台上实现地图的相关技术。
通过这个教程,读者不仅能够掌握OPhone游戏开发的基础知识,还能了解到2D游戏编程的基本思路。不过需要注意的是,由于文章是基于OPhoneSDK v1.0编写的,随着时间的推移,代码、图片和链接可能已过时,需要读者自行更新到最新的开发工具和SDK版本以保持兼容性。
这篇教程是适合有一定编程基础的学习者踏入OPhone游戏开发领域的理想起点,通过实践和理论结合的方式,帮助读者快速上手并激发他们的创新潜力。
相关推荐










lovedlj
- 粉丝: 0
最新资源
- 深入TCP-IP卷三:掌握HTTP、NNTP及UNIX域协议
- C++实现路径分解:splitpath函数详细介绍
- SSH Secure Shell - Linux部署工具的高效选择
- 冰点文库1.8:全新压缩包子文件管理
- 基于JSP+Servlet+JavaBean的留言板实现教程
- VST宿主vsthost_1.52_x64:64位VST插件运行环境
- WinSock下的简单TCP Socket通信编程教程
- JAVA面试题及答案汇总,助力笔试面试成功
- 下载日本wonderFL的绚丽FL效果集合
- 广东商学院2011大型数据库试题详解与得分分享
- 深入理解Verilog HDL数字设计与综合程序实践
- 51单片机实现USB Mass Storage通信协议
- 中小型零售店必备 立风POS综合管理软件
- 无需原装光盘,在XP系统中轻松建立网站的教程
- DisSharp 3.11:C#开发者的必备反编译与调试工具
- checkstyle插件包4.0.0版本下载指南
- C#备忘录闹钟控件源代码可二次开发
- C#委托基础教程及示例代码
- Java人事管理系统源码、论文及答辩PPT完整资料
- 详细指南:使用DotNetNuke部署和升级.NET CMS系统
- Java电子邮件发送示例教程
- 模仿百度文库的在线文档查看源码实现
- ASP.NET AJAX框架完全指南及客户端编程技巧
- jQuery EasyUI API官方文档中文完整版